The Ward Housekeeper will work as a team member on Starlight Neonatal Unit under the direction/guidance of the Sister/Charge Nurse or his/her nominated deputy. The focus of the role is to support the nursing team by cleaning/decontaminating equipments, ensuring stock levels of items required are adequate and available, keeping the area clean and tidy, reporting any faulty equipment and estates issues appropriately. The post holder will work as part of a multi-disciplinary team.
The Royal Free London NHS Foundation Trust is one of the UK’s biggest and most innovative trusts. Across three main hospitals, our dedicated army of staff care for over 1.6million patients, treat more than 200,000 in A&E, deliver over 8,000 babies and carry out more than 17million tests.
